Opinion
Guest column: New Orleans' politics infected with too much 'bullgas.' We need to get rid of it.
As citizens of New Orleans, we are the true owners of Team New Orleans. We choose the leaders, but the scoreboard tells the story: Our city has lost 30,000 people ...
The Briel Avenue train depot, built in 1891 for the New Orleans and Northwestern Railroad, once connected downtown via South 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results